摘要
汞具有易迁移性、生物富集性和剧毒性,一直是全球关注的重点污染物之一。吸附法作为一种较为成熟、经济、有效的废水中汞处理方法,目前受到广泛的研究。利用13X型分子筛、硝酸银和硼氢化钠制备成的银掺杂改性分子筛吸附剂,在吸附温度为20℃、pH为3、吸附剂投放量为0.3 g、吸附时间为40 min、共存氯离子摩尔浓度为0.3 mol·L^(-1)等试验条件下,模拟工业废水中汞离子的去除率达到88%以上,且使用氯化钾和硝酸混合液对吸附剂的洗脱率达到89.3%,吸附剂经高温活化再生后,对模拟废水中汞的去除率仍然达到82.2%。在此基础上,实验还初步考察了模拟废水中汞的初始浓度对吸附剂吸附性能的影响。结果表明:该吸附剂制备工艺简单、对工艺废水中汞的去除率高、吸附后洗脱率高、再生方法简单且可重复利用,展现出良好的应用前景。
Mercury has been one of the key pollutants of global concern due to its easy mobility,bioaccumulation and toxicity.As a mature,economical and effective treatment method of mercury in wastewater,adsorption process has been widely studied.In this paper,the silver-doped modified molecular sieve adsorbent was prepared from 13X molecular sieve,silver nitrate and sodium borohydride.Under the experimental conditions of adsorption temperature of 20℃,pH of 3,adsorbent dosage of 0.3 g,adsorption time of 40 min,and coexisting chloride ion concentration of 0.3 mol·L^(-1),the removal rate of mercury ions in simulated industrial wastewater was more than 88%,and the elution rate of the adsorbent using the mixture of potassium chloride and nitric acid reached 89.3%.After the adsorbent was activated and regenerated at high temperature,the removal rate of mercury in simulated wastewater still reached 82.2%.The effect of initial mercury concentration in simulated wastewater on the adsorption performance of adsorbents was also investigated.The results showed that the adsorbent had simple preparation process,high removal rate of mercury in process wastewater,high elution rate after adsorption,simple regeneration method and reusability,showing a good application prospect.
